About the role
As an Associate, Bilingual Client Services Representative, you will service international (non-US residents) and domestic clients with all a full range of service and trading needs. You will work in a collaborative, fast-paced environment to assist with trading stocks, ETFs, mutual funds and options in addition to general account servicing inquiries. You will also complete document translation services for internal partners and service clients in foreign language as needed. Evening and overnight shifts will also support our clients within Stock Plan Services.

Requirements
- In addition to English, must be able to read, write, and speak in Mandarin/Cantonese
- Series 7 & 63 licenses required OR a condition of employment to successfully obtain these licenses within the allotted training time
- Well-developed and effective communication skills to establish trust and rapport with clients through both verbal and written communication
- Available to work in a structured schedule and adhere to assigned schedule including lunch and break time as pre-determined by business need
- Positive attitude, enthusiasm, professionalism, and strong work ethic with high level of integrity and ethics
- Willingness and desire to learn in a fast-paced and evolving environment
Qualifications
- 2+ years of college study in finance, economics, business administration, or related area; bachelor’s degree is preferred
- 2+ years of customer service experience, preferably in financial services; 1+ years of experience working with clients through phone/chats/emails
- Basic to intermediate knowledge of investment products. Ability to explain these complex subjects via the phone
- Ability to quickly identify client needs, demonstrate empathy and compassion in responses, and apply sound judgment when taking action(s) to achieve client objectives via phone/chat/email
- Flexible and able to work on emails/chats/phones as business needs change
- High flexibility in shift times especially early in the morning as business needs
